Servings          
Original recipe makes 24 Servings
1/2 cupbutter
1 1/2 cupssugar
1 egg
1 cuppumpkin; canned (NOT pumpkin pie mix, 100% pumpkin only)
2 1/2 cupsflour
1 teaspoonbaking powder
1 teaspoonbaking soda
1 teaspooncinnamon
1 teaspoonnutmeg
1/2 teaspoonsalt
12 ozchocolate chips; 6-12 oz (depending on how chocolaty you want it)

Best Pumpkin Chocolate Chip Cookies Preparation

*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ees

Cream together butter & sugar; add in egg, pumpkin and vanilla; beat well. Stir dry ingredients together and add to pumpkin mixture; add chocolate chips.

Place on greased cookie sheet, bake for 13-14 minutes (to test for doneness, lightly press finger into cookie; it should come pack up slightly)
